I first saw Santana at Rob Gym, UCSB, I think December 1968, Quicksilver headlining.  Their first album had not come out yet.  I think they played again in early '69.  Over the years I've seen them a bunch, mainly at Dead shows.  Caught him sitting in with Eric Clapton at Frost for that song from Tommy.

His band used to rehearse next door on Folsom St. to my shop, so I've heard him through the walls more times than I can count, met many different band members, as they always seemed to be quitting and returning.  Worked with at least 3 of his bass players on basses.

Got to hand it to him, long career making music.  Not a bad fate, eh?
